Rogaška both celebrated and sinned: Mura spoil the return of top-flight football to Rogaška Slatina after 30 long years

After 30 long years, top-flight football has returned to Rogaška Slatina. A rainy Saturday brought the first ever match Rogaška
on home soil in the 2023/24 season, but the premiere did not end as the Black and Whites had hoped. At least not those from Rogaška Slatina… The match was won by Mura, who scored two goals in the ninth round of the Telemach First League through Amadej Maroša and Matic Marušek, but Rogaška will continue to beat themselves on the head for a long time because of the many missed chances.



Although the leaders of Rogaška and the Football Association of Slovenia have been on more than friendly terms in recent times, the umbrella organisation also attended the opening ceremony of the renovated stadium. The delegation was led by NZS president Radenko Mijatović, who also cut the ceremonial ribbon to officially open the facility, the renovation of which cost more than one million euros.
Mura scored their first goal in the 19th. In the first minute, after a pass by Žan Trontelj from the right wing, Amadej Maroša was quicker than Rok Vodišek and sent the ball behind the back of the Rogaška goalkeeper from close range. The second goal came in the 89th minute. Matic Maruško beat Vodišek in the final minute. Mura made a long run, taking the ball from the left side of their own half all the way to the Rogaska goal. Žiga Kous passed and Maruško scored with a precisely timed left-footed shot.


Rogaška had a couple of chances between the two goals, but Klemen Mihelak didn’t let them beat him. The fact that the home team fired 14 shots (Mura six), but the ball only went into the Prekmurje giant’s goal three times, shows how wasteful Rogaška was in attack….
